Why Understanding Penny Stocks Matters
Investing in penny stocks requires a clear understanding of their inherent characteristics and the market dynamics that influence their price movements. Here’s why:
1. High Growth Potential and Accelerated Returns: Penny stocks can experience rapid price appreciation in short periods, offering the potential for accelerated returns compared to larger, more established companies.
Example: A penny stock in the electric vehicle (EV) charging infrastructure sector, securing a partnership with a major EV manufacturer, could witness a significant surge in demand and a subsequent substantial price increase.
2. Affordability and Leverage: Their low price allows investors to acquire a larger number of shares with a smaller capital outlay, effectively leveraging potential price movements. This amplifies the impact of even small price changes.
Example: With ₹10,000, you can buy 1,000 shares of a ₹10 stock versus only 100 shares of a ₹100 stock. A ₹2 price increase in the ₹10 stock represents a 20% return, whereas the same ₹2 increase in the ₹100 stock is only a 2% return.
3. Potential for Multibagger Returns and Wealth Creation: If a penny stock’s business model proves successful and gains market traction, the returns can be exponential, turning small investments into significant wealth over time.
Example: A biotechnology penny stock successfully completing a crucial drug trial and receiving FDA approval could see its valuation multiply rapidly, delivering multibagger returns to early investors.
4. Higher Volatility and Liquidity Risks: Penny stocks are inherently more susceptible to market fluctuations, speculative trading, and lower trading volumes (liquidity), which can lead to significant price swings and difficulty in buying or selling shares quickly.
Example: A small sell-off in a thinly traded penny stock with low liquidity can lead to a disproportionately large price drop due to a lack of buyers willing to absorb the selling pressure.
Key Characteristics of Promising Penny Stocks
Identifying penny stocks with substantial growth potential requires looking for specific traits:
1. Strong Revenue Growth and Expanding Market Share: Companies showing consistent revenue increase and demonstrating an ability to capture a larger portion of their target market are more likely to attract investor interest and achieve sustainable growth.
Example: A penny stock in the renewable energy sector demonstrating consistent quarter-over-quarter revenue growth and expanding its installation network across multiple states suggests strong business momentum and market penetration.
2. Improving Financials and Prudent Debt Management: Look for companies with decreasing debt-to-equity ratios (a measure of financial leverage) and increasing cash flow from operations, indicating improving financial health and efficient use of capital. A lower debt-to-equity ratio generally indicates lower financial risk.
3. Catalyst for Growth and Market Disruption: A new product launch, expansion into new markets, a strategic partnership, or disruptive technology can act as a catalyst for growth and drive investor interest.
Example: A penny stock developing a patented AI-powered diagnostic tool for healthcare could see its stock price rise significantly upon successful clinical trial results and subsequent regulatory approvals.
4. Sector Trends and Favorable Market Tailwinds: Aligning with growing sectors like technology, renewable energy, or emerging industries experiencing favorable market conditions (tailwinds) can significantly boost growth potential.
5. Competent Management and Strong Corporate Governance: Experienced and transparent leadership with a clear vision, a proven track record, and strong corporate governance practices are crucial for long-term success and building investor confidence.
Top Sectors for Penny Stock Opportunities
Certain sectors offer more fertile ground for penny stock investments due to their growth potential and dynamic nature:
1. Technology and IT:
Why It’s Promising: Rapid technological advancements, increasing demand for digital solutions, and the potential for disruptive innovations.
Example Opportunities: Small software development firms specialising in niche areas like cybersecurity or AI, emerging IT service providers offering innovative solutions.
2. Renewable Energy:
Why It’s Promising: Growing global focus on sustainable energy, government incentives, and increasing investment in renewable energy infrastructure.
Example Opportunities: Small solar panel installers, emerging battery technology companies, and companies involved in the development of green hydrogen technologies.
3. Specialty Chemicals and Manufacturing:
Why It’s Promising: Niche players with unique products or services can gain significant market share in specialised industries.
Example Opportunities: Companies specialising in specific chemical compounds for industrial applications or niche manufacturing processes for specialised equipment.
